Mercedes make huge George Russell admission after Lewis Hamilton drama

Mercedes' head of trackside engineering Andrew Shovlin has admitted that the Silver Arrows didn't expect George Russell to recover to fourth at the Qatar Grand Prix, after colliding with Lewis Hamilton on the opening lap. Last weekend's race at the Lusail International Circuit started in the worst way possible for Mercedes, as Hamilton cut across the front of Russell at the opening corner. Both drivers span out of the top three as a result, with Hamilton having lost a wheel and become beached in the gravel, causing the seven-time World Champion to retire from the race.
